package org.junit;

import org.hamcrest.Matcher;

An exception class used to implement assumptions (state in which a given test is meaningful and should or should not be executed). A test for which an assumption fails should not generate a test case failure.
See Also:
  • Assume
Since:4.12
/** * An exception class used to implement <i>assumptions</i> (state in which a given test * is meaningful and should or should not be executed). A test for which an assumption * fails should not generate a test case failure. * * @see org.junit.Assume * @since 4.12 */
@SuppressWarnings("deprecation") public class AssumptionViolatedException extends org.junit.internal.AssumptionViolatedException { private static final long serialVersionUID = 1L;
An assumption exception with the given actual value and a matcher describing the expectation that failed.
/** * An assumption exception with the given <i>actual</i> value and a <i>matcher</i> describing * the expectation that failed. */
public <T> AssumptionViolatedException(T actual, Matcher<T> matcher) { super(actual, matcher); }
An assumption exception with a message with the given actual value and a matcher describing the expectation that failed.
/** * An assumption exception with a message with the given <i>actual</i> value and a * <i>matcher</i> describing the expectation that failed. */
public <T> AssumptionViolatedException(String message, T expected, Matcher<T> matcher) { super(message, expected, matcher); }
An assumption exception with the given message only.
/** * An assumption exception with the given message only. */
public AssumptionViolatedException(String message) { super(message); }
An assumption exception with the given message and a cause.
/** * An assumption exception with the given message and a cause. */
public AssumptionViolatedException(String message, Throwable t) { super(message, t); } }
